Top English Clubs Show Renewed Interest in Israeli Player Anan Khalaily After Failed Transfer
Anan Khalaily, an Israeli national team player, recently saw a high-profile transfer collapse due to medical examination issues. The deal, valued at around 25 million euros, fell through, leaving his future uncertain. Despite this setback, several major clubs remain interested in acquiring him.
Khalaily's father revealed that English Premier League club Ipswich Town had shown strong interest in signing his son and has yet to fill the position Khalaily would occupy. Additionally, Newcastle United and Crystal Palace, which employs a 5-3-2 formation, were also keen on the player and may re-enter negotiations.
Previously, Italian clubs Napoli, Cagliari, and Como had expressed a desire to sign Khalaily. However, the medical results effectively ruled out a move to the Italian league, prompting the player to consider opportunities in other leagues, with the English Premier League being a likely destination.
The situation remains fluid as interested clubs evaluate their options, and Khalaily's next move could significantly impact his career trajectory.
